与View.CurrentItem的奇怪CommandParameter

时间:2011-06-12 15:50:28

标签: c# .net wpf data-binding mvvm

我在ViewModel集合中有ICollectionView view;嗯,在XAML中我有

<Button ... Command="cmdDelete" CommandParameter="{Binding view.CurrentItem}" />

但这很奇怪,因为点击时CommandParameter没有得到解决。我得到一些不反映CurrentItem的值。

更新:视图创建为CollectionViewSource.GetDefaultView(observablecollection);,此集合已绑定到DataGrid.ItemsSource

1 个答案:

答案 0 :(得分:3)

使用它:

CommandParameter="{Binding view/}"